Surrounded by picturesque scenery, ancient castles, and thermal baths, Grand Hotel Billia welcomes guests in the heart of the popular spa town of Saint Vincent since 1908.
Set in Bard in the Aosta Valley, 328 feet from the panoramic elevator to Fort Bard, Hotel Ad Gallias offers wellness facilities and a rooftop terrace overlooking the fort.
